  • Water billing: New York requires water and utility charges in a manufactured home park to be reasonably related to the actual cost of service, not a profit center (RPL §233(g)). Check the math free with the water submeter calculator.

How much can lot rent go up at Hudson View Terrace?

New York requires at least 90 days' written notice before a lot-rent increase, and any increase above 3% can be challenged in court as unjustified — with a 6% ceiling absent court-approved hardship relief (Real Property Law §§233(g), 233-b).
